III Semester Electronics & Telecommunication Engineering Electronics Measurements UNIT-I: Statistical analysis of measurement of errors, accuracy, Precision, types of errors, Fundamental and Derived units, conversion of units. Classification of standards: for mass, length, time, volume, frequency, temperature light intensity, electrical properties. UNIT-II: PMMC galvanometer, dc voltmeter, ammeter, multimeter, Watt-hour meter, three phase wattmeter, power factor meter instrument transformers. Measurement of low, medium & high resistance. UNIT-III: Bridges: Wheat stone, Kelvin, Max-well, Hay, Schering, Wienbridge. Potentiometers, Measurement of Inductance, Capacitance using AC Bridge. UNIT-IV: Amplified dc meters, Ac voltmeter using rectifiers, True/RMS voltmeter, Electronics Multimeter, Digital Voltmeter, Component measuring instruments, Q-meter, RF power and voltage measurement. UNIT-V: Oscilloscopes: Block Diagram, CRT deflection system, delay line multiple trace, triggering, delayed sweep, digital storage oscilloscope. UNIT-VI: Frequency, Time and Power measurement signal analysis. Text Books: 1. Electronics Instrumentation and Measurement Techniques by Copper and Helfrick, PHI Publications. Reference Books: 1. Electronics Instrumentation by Terman & Petil. 2. Electronics Instrumentation by Kalsi (TMH Pub.) 3. Electronics Measurement and Instrumentation by Oliver (TMH Pub.) 4. Measurement Analysis by Earnest Frank. 5. Electric Measurement and Measuring Instruments by Drydate and Jolley. 6. Electric and Electronic Measurement and Measuring Instruments by Rama Bhadra (Khanna Pub.)
